Glen Garioch 20 Years Old

ABV: 52.1% 70 cL

Distilled in 2006 at Glen Garioch Distillery in Oldmeldrum, within Scotland’s Highland region, this single malt spent 20 years maturing in two red wine barriques. The long ageing period brings a rich, layered profile, with flavours of blackcurrant cordial, warming cinnamon chewing tobacco, and ripe damsons.

Bottled at natural cask strength, without chill-filtration or artificial colouring by Thompson Bros.

Nose

Blackcurrant concentrate, marzipan, pastry, sun dried raisins, sun dried tomatoes(?), violets, brambles, plums and cherry liqueur.

Palate

Sour patch kids, Ribena, cinnamon, chewing tobacco, damsons, figs and ground black pepper. Some bitter orange at the end, almost like grand marnier.

Finish

Long, dry and tannic with some dark cacao and a slightly acetic edge.

Glen Garioch Distillery was officially founded in 1797, although there are claims it may have been active even earlier. Like many other distilleries, Glen Garioch has changed hands multiple times over the years and has endured periods of mothballing, shifts in style, and numerous renovations. Today, this Highland gem—nestled in the heart of Oldmeldrum village in Aberdeenshire—is known for producing fruity whiskies with a distinctive touch of spice.
